KID KOBBIE TIPPED FOR A FINE FUTURE

-

GARETH SOUTHGATE is convinced Kobbie Mainoo has the footballin­g world at his feet.

The teenage sensation (inset) capped his meteoric rise by making his Three Lions debut as a sub in the 1-0 defeat to Brazil on Saturday.

It came just four months after the midfielder had made his Premier League debut for Manchester United.

Mainoo, 18, is expected to start when England host Belgium at Wembley tonight.

And Southgate admits Mainoo has taken to internatio­nal football like a duck to water.

He said: “You can see he is taking everything in. Talking to him tactically, he seems able to take all those concepts on.

“You can see he is comfortabl­e with the ball and receiving it in tight areas.

“There are a lot of steps being taken in a very short period of time, but you saw in the brief cameo the other day some of by JEREMY CROSS the qualities he has. It is a beautiful, innocent moment when he is just in the flow. And lapping up the opportunit­ies as they come.

“We are really happy to see how he has dealt with training and we see things he can bring already.” Declan Rice is also impressed with Mainoo and said: “Every time I’ve seen him playing for United on the TV, he has been pretty much their best player every game. “He’s really, really impressive. He’s at one of the biggest clubs in the world and now he’s at England, we just want to let him flourish. He’s so composed.

“I have come across so many 18-year-olds who are top players but don’t have that full package. “The sky is the limit for him. He’s an amazing player and I am looking forward to playing many games for England with him.”
